Summary:
The Senate Committee on Border Security heard Senator Birdwell present SB 2202, which would create a state offense for knowingly transferring a firearm for profit or other remuneration to a member of a foreign terrorist organization. Birdwell argued the bill responds to cartel violence and southbound gun trafficking, and he explained a committee substitute that removed an exemption for federally licensed gun dealers and removed a requirement that DPS coordinate with Mexican law enforcement. He said the goal was to give Texas a state-level tool if federal enforcement is lacking.
Invited testimony came from DPS Colonel Freeman Martin and border prosecution unit chair Tanya Ash. Both said the bill could be useful in some organized-crime and cartel cases, but they emphasized that proving a defendant knowingly transferred a gun to a foreign terrorist organization would be difficult and would usually require strong direct or circumstantial evidence, such as recorded statements, informants, or coordinated investigations. They said the measure would be more workable in complex cartel cases than in routine patrol stops, and they noted existing state and federal tools already address straw purchases, firearms trafficking, and related offenses. Members also discussed tracing seized firearms, cooperation with ATF, and the limits of state jurisdiction over international issues. No public testimony was offered, and SB 2202 was left pending.
The committee then took up SB 36 as pending business. A committee substitute was adopted without objection, and the substitute bill was reported favorably to the full Senate by a 4-0 vote, with Senators Birdwell, Flores, Hinojosa of Hidalgo, Eckhardt, and Hinojosa of Nueces participating. The committee also accepted a motion in writing and ordered the bill recommended for local and uncontested calendar placement. The chair then announced the committee would recess subject to call.
